Man dies after assault at adult care center in Hayes, west London.

A 44-year-old inhabitant of the area has been arrested on suspicion of murder, according to the Metropolitan Police.

A murder investigation has been initiated following the death of a man at a treatment facility. For adults with mental health and substance misuse concerns.

The 60-year-old died soon before midnight on Monday. At the Imperial Lodge care facility in Hayes, west London, after being assaulted.

The individual, a resident of the facility, was treated by paramedics but pronounced dead at the site.

A representative of the force stated: “Monday, January 2, at approximately 11:50 p.m. the police were notified of an attack at an adult care home on Lansbury Drive in Hayes.

“Officers and the London Ambulance Service were present. Despite the rescue services’ best efforts, a 60-year-old man was pronounced deceased at the scene.

“The deceased’s next of kin have been notified, and an autopsy will be scheduled in due time.

“A 44-year-old male was arrested at the scene. And he is in custody at a west London police station on suspicion of murder.

“Both the deceased and the arrested individual were facility inhabitants.”

A witness reported seeing flashing police vehicles and ambulances in the roadway outside the facility.

The witness, who did not wish to be identified. Stated, “I observed numerous police cars and ambulances with flashing lights but no sirens.”
